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Skripten / Logik
    4. [gelöst] View-Wechsel über CCU klappt nur ein Mal

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    [gelöst] View-Wechsel über CCU klappt nur ein Mal

    This topic has been deleted. Only users with topic management privileges can see it.
    • B
      brufi last edited by

      Hallo liebe Fachleute,

      ich bin neu hier und versuche mich an meinem ersten Script (Copy Paste) und ich habe leider nur teilweise Erfolg - eventuell kann mir einer von Euch den entscheidenden Hinweis geben, ich versuche mein Problem mal zu schildern.

      Ich möchte zum Testen über einen Homematic-Taster (egal ob Wired oder Funk) in VIS eine View wechseln und automatisiert wieder zurückstellen.

      Das klappt auch wunderbar - allerdings nur beim ersten Tastendruck.

      on("hm-rpc.0.XXX0123456.5.PRESS_SHORT"/*HM-PB-6-WM55 XXX0123456:1.PRESS_SHORT*/, function (obj){
          if (obj.newState.val) {
      
                 setState("vis.0.control.instance", 'FFFFFFFF');
                 setState("vis.0.control.data",     'Galaxy-TAB10/galaxy-eg-licht');
                 setState("vis.0.control.command",  'changeView'); 
                 //Nach 10 Sekunden, zeige wieder Start View
                 setTimeout(function () {
                 setState("vis.0.control.instance", 'FFFFFFFF');
                 setState("vis.0.control.data",     'Galaxy-TAB10/galaxy-nav01');
                 setState("vis.0.control.command",  'changeView');    
                 }, 10000);
          }
      });
      

      Sobald "true" in der iobroker-Objects-Ansicht bei diesem Object steht (das ist am Anfang, wenn noch keine Taste gedrückt ist, leer), klappt der View-Wechsel nur noch, wenn ich in dieser Ansicht auf "True" klicke und dann das Häkchen anklicke. Weder mit dem Taster noch aus der CCU-WebUI heraus wird die View beim weiteren Tastendruck geändert.

      Kann mir hier bitte jemand auf die Sprünge helfen?

      Danke und Gruß,

      Brufi

      1 Reply Last reply Reply Quote 0
      • Bluefox
        Bluefox last edited by

        > on({id: "hm-rpc.0.XXX0123456.5.PRESS_SHORT"/*HM-PB-6-WM55 XXX0123456:1.PRESS_SHORT*/, change: 'any'}, function…

        1 Reply Last reply Reply Quote 0
        • P
          pix last edited by

          Oder
          > on({id: "hm-rpc.0.XXX0123456.5.PRESS_SHORT"/*HM-PB-6-WM55 XXX0123456:1.PRESS_SHORT*/, val: 'true'}, function…

          1 Reply Last reply Reply Quote 0
          • B
            brufi last edited by

            Ihr seid die Besten!! 😄

            Danke!!

            Off Topic: Geile Software - geiles Projekt!!

            1 Reply Last reply Reply Quote 0
            • First post
              Last post

            Support us

            ioBroker
            Community Adapters
            Donate

            895
            Online

            31.9k
            Users

            80.2k
            Topics

            1.3m
            Posts

            3
            4
            714
            Loading More Posts
            • Oldest to Newest
            • Newest to Oldest
            • Most Votes
            Reply
            • Reply as topic
            Log in to reply
            Community
            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
            The ioBroker Community 2014-2023
            logo